My panels are starting to fade, what would be a good solution? As for painting it, I don't know how about going at it, like what paint and stuff? I want it the same stock color/look. I dislike colorful interors :p
 
you might try griots garage plastic cleaner, and they have a rejuivinator as well, it works very well. . . only good enough for pebble beach concourse winners. :D
 
You could try and get vinyl dye. Its sprays on like spray paint but it is way better on plastics. You can get it in all colors, so you can pick any stock color interior you want. It wont chip or flake off like spray paint either.
